Transaction 7851ff331e7260bedfd99f54e3cb512ac2a62a9f272ab33c7a92beb36d861b1e
1 Input
1 Output
-
7851ff331e7260bedfd99f54e3cb512ac2a62a9f272ab33c7a92beb36d861b1e:0
- value
- 1293520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 170d9b303706bcc674ac2f22001c60c3ecb085be OP_EQUAL
- address
- 33numLBTgs9ybCk8yxxXPwSz3pVpLXqCNs